WebIn Windows, look in the task bar tray on the far right (assuming the bar is on the bottom). There should be a grey diamond-shaped icon. Right-click that and a menu pops up. “Restart in MacOS” should be an option in that menu. Click that. WebLearn how to switch between Windows and Mac Using Boot Camp without holding the option key. WebPower off the machine and then turn it back on. As soon as it has power, start pressing the option key, a prompt should appear that allows you to choose MacOS or Windows. Simply choose MacOS.
